Bremspropeller Posted July 5, 2022 Share Posted July 5, 2022 (edited) The horizontal stabilizer has been going LE down in landing gains ever since initial EA release of the Viper. It's more pronounced with a fwd CoG (e.g. TGP and or HTS pods on the chin). That behaviour has been wrong ever since, as the F-16 stabs are noticeably neutral on approach. For what we're seeing in game, check out Wags' ILS tutorial - on a clean jet, the stabs will go about 5° LE down. You don't actaully have to watch the video, it's evident on the thumbnail picture. Note the stabs are more or less in parallel with the horizon, indicating an "in trim" position for a conventional aircraft. On an actual Viper, the stabs don't work that way - check out this HAF Block 52: And this USAF Block 42: It seems like there's some weird issue with the CoG or the way the FLCS handes it in game. I was kind of hoping the ITR update would make the issue disappear, however it's still there. Bremspropeller Posted July 5, 2022 Author Share Posted July 5, 2022 (edited) FLCS_test_clean.trkFLCS_test_heavy.trk Here are the associated tracks. I built a mission that puts me on a 16NM final - once in a clean bird and once in a laden-up bird to show the difference and similarities. I'm trying to slow down at about 1kt/s ish. Dropping the gear at 250KCAS and deploying the boards a few seconds later. What's evident right away is that the stabs are fighting the TEF deployment. TEFs are coming down with the LG lever down. I'm flying the approach at 10-11° AoA but I'm slowing down to 13° AoA above the beach to show the effect of AoA - it slightly worsens the stab position, as expected due to the increased downwash.
